Update symbols_with_libdwarf.cpp

fix compiler warn
This commit is contained in:
Infko 2024-06-05 09:46:29 +08:00 committed by GitHub
parent 8234de1e2b
commit 49f8315cbf
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-44,7 +44,7 @@ namespace libdwarf {
// .emplace needed, for some reason .insert tries to copy <= gcc 7.2
return resolver_map.emplace(object_name, std::move(resolver_object)).first->second.get();
} else {
return std::move(resolver_object);
return maybe_owned<symbol_resolver>{std::move(resolver_object)};
}
}
}